TOUR HIGHLIGHTS

Colombo: Sri Lanka’s vibrant capital is both a historic city packed with colonial architecture and a modern metropolis with soaring skyscrapers.

Dambulla: An icon in the face of Sri Lanka, Dambulla Rock Temple houses some of the unique drawings in magnificently constructed five cave temples flanking the golden temple of Dambulla.

Kandy: This beautiful city is home to the outstanding Temple of the Sacred Tooth Relic and its associated palaces and gardens.

Sigiriya: The ‘Lion Rock’ rises almost 200 metres above the jungle, offerings stunning panoramic views that will amaze your eyes.

Minneriya National Park: Spanning over 8,800 hectares, the Minneriya National Park is located alongside the vast, renovated Minneriya Rainwater Reservoir.

Nuwara Eliya: Misty steep roads, twisting through lush green blankets of tea bushes in a cool climate, remind visitors that they are within the range of this renowned British colonial retreat.

Know before you go

Comfortable and light clothing is the most suitable for travelling in Sri Lanka. Visitors should not wear sleeveless shirts, shorts, short skirts or skimpy clothing when visiting temples, religious or official buildings. Shoes should be removed before entering a temple or private house. Sun protection, sunglasses, a hat and mosquito repellent can be very useful during your stay. The validity of the passport must be six months from the date of departure. Please note that all clients will need to check the website and obtain a visa prior to arrival in Sri Lanka excluding citizens of Singapore and Maldives. The government has reported that all applications will be processed within 48 hours and payment can be made online by credit card. Details are available on the portal: www.eta.gov.lk.
